Explorers at Work: Asha De Vos

Explorers at Work: Asha De Vos

National Geographic Explorer, marine biologist and ocean educator Asha de Vos pioneers long-term blue whale research in the Indian Ocean. Sri Lankan born, she has encountered many over the years who have found her to be too young and too female in a traditionally male dominated field. Despite this she has carved her own niche and these days, what keeps Asha going is the question that many in the field are also facing: how do we coexist with the rest of Earth’s species?
